Fix neutron-lbaas gates

Broken by https://review.openstack.org/#/c/343045/ finally merging.

Change-Id: Idf0443ec84cc007eb99c0bba82c8318356cc5f2a
This commit is contained in:
Adam Harwell 2017-03-16 05:32:13 +09:00
parent b8e64121d5
commit 772c1dbd79
3 changed files with 5 additions and 18 deletions

View File

@ -15,11 +15,11 @@
import sys
from neutron.agent.common import config
from neutron.agent.linux import external_process
from neutron.agent.linux import interface
from neutron.common import config as common_config
from neutron.common import rpc as n_rpc
from neutron.conf.agent import common as config
from oslo_config import cfg
from oslo_service import service

View File

@ -12,8 +12,8 @@
import itertools
import neutron.agent.common.config
import neutron.agent.linux.interface
import neutron.conf.agent.common
import neutron.conf.services.provider_configuration
import neutron_lbaas.agent.agent
@ -27,26 +27,13 @@ import neutron_lbaas.drivers.radware.base_v2_driver
import neutron_lbaas.extensions.loadbalancerv2
# TODO(johndperkins): Remove when https://review.openstack.org/#/c/343045
# merges
try:
import neutron.conf.agent.common
except ImportError:
pass
try:
_INTERFACE_DRIVER_OPTS = neutron.agent.common.config.INTERFACE_DRIVER_OPTS
except AttributeError:
_INTERFACE_DRIVER_OPTS = neutron.conf.agent.common.INTERFACE_DRIVER_OPTS
def list_agent_opts():
return [
('DEFAULT',
itertools.chain(
neutron_lbaas.agent.agent.OPTS,
neutron.agent.linux.interface.OPTS,
_INTERFACE_DRIVER_OPTS)
neutron.conf.agent.common.INTERFACE_DRIVER_OPTS)
),
('haproxy',
neutron_lbaas.drivers.haproxy.namespace_driver.OPTS)
@ -80,7 +67,7 @@ def list_service_opts():
neutron_lbaas.drivers.radware.base_v2_driver.driver_debug_opts),
('haproxy',
itertools.chain(
_INTERFACE_DRIVER_OPTS,
neutron.conf.agent.common.INTERFACE_DRIVER_OPTS,
neutron_lbaas.agent.agent.OPTS,
)),
('octavia',

View File

@ -34,7 +34,7 @@ class TestLbaasService(base.BaseTestCase):
self.assertTrue(mock_start.called)
def test_main(self):
logging_str = 'neutron.agent.common.config.setup_logging'
logging_str = 'neutron.conf.agent.common.setup_logging'
with mock.patch(logging_str), \
mock.patch.object(agent.service, 'launch') as mock_launch, \
mock.patch('sys.argv'), \